How much do collections skip tracing j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 5, 2026, the average hourly pay for collections skip tracing in California is $21.18,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.55 and $23.70 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a collections skip tracing?

A Collections Skip Tracing job involves locating individuals who have outstanding debts but have become difficult to contact. Skip tracers use various tools, databases, and investigative techniques to track down debtors' current contact information. They may search public records, credit reports, social media, and other sources to find updated addresses, phone numbers, or employment details. This role is crucial in assisting debt collectors with recovering unpaid balances while adhering to legal and ethical guidelines.

What are the common challenges faced in a collections skip tracing role?

One of the main challenges in Collections Skip Tracing is dealing with limited or outdated information, which requires creative problem-solving and persistence to locate individuals. Professionals in this role often need to balance investigative work with maintaining professionalism and compliance with legal guidelines. Skip tracers may also encounter uncooperative or difficult contacts, making effective communication and negotiation skills essential. Despite these challenges, the role offers variety and the satisfaction of resolving complex cases within a supportive team environ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in collections skip tracing,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Collections Skip Tracing professional, you need strong investigative abilities, attention to detail, and a background in collections or related fields. Familiarity with skip tracing databases, credit reporting systems, and CRM software is often expected. Excellent communication, persistence, and critical thinking skills set top performers apart. These capabilities are crucial for efficiently locating debtors, verifying information, and facilitating successful debt recovery efforts.

Do collections skip tracers make good money?

Collections skip tracers typically earn an hourly wage or commission-based pay, with salaries ranging from around $30,000 to $60,000 annually depending on experience and location. Skilled tracers who develop strong investigative techniques and use tools like skip tracing software can increase their earning potential. Compensation may also include bonuses or incentives based on recovery success rates.
